Contactless Patient Check-In Kiosk Definition

A contactless patient check-in kiosk is a self-service kiosk hardware and software package that allows patients to check in for appointments, scan an ID or insurance card, sign documents, and make a payment without touching a shared screen or speaking with front-desk staff face-to-face.

Contactless kiosks do not require traditional data entry or manual check-in; they are image-based and use computer vision to acquire critical patient data in real time and high definition. Whether on a counter, wall, or floor-stand model, the kiosk can provide custom guidance for the patient through a digital workflow from arrival to registration.

How Contactless Check-In Works

A typical patient check-in journey using Aila’s platform may look like this:

  1. Arrival & Greeting
    Patients are greeted by a branded, intuitive kiosk interface positioned at the entrance or waiting area. 
  2. Contactless ID or Insurance Scan
    Using Aila’s high-performance image-based scanning technology, patients can scan their driver’s license, insurance card, or QR code. 
  3. Auto-Form Completion
    Patient information is automatically taken from IDs, insurance cards, or an in-app QR code to fill out forms and complete check-ins.  
  4. Confirmation & Wayfinding
    Once complete, the kiosk can print a ticket or display a confirmation message, directing patients to the appropriate waiting area or treatment room. 
  5. Real-Time Integration
    Patient responses are collected automatically and fed directly into the provider’s registration system or electronic health record, ensuring that backend systems stay current without manual entry.

This occurs in minutes or less, providing the patients with a private, secure, and stress-free experience. It is advantageous in high-throughput or high-stress environments such as emergency rooms and urgent care facilities.

Why Healthcare Providers Are Adopting Contactless Kiosks

1. Reduced Wait Times and Line Elimination

Waiting in line is one of the most significant pain points for patient intake. Patients can be checked into these facilities in a “touchless” manner via the check-in kiosk in the waiting room, arriving and leaving rather than standing and queuing.

Example: One Aila customer in diagnostics cut check-in times by several minutes per patient, freeing up staff to concentrate on care.

2. Better Patient Experience and More Satisfied Patients

Patients value independence, particularly when it comes to increasing privacy and convenience. With contactless kiosks, that embarrassment of repeating personal details over and over again is gone, and you have a user-friendly interface.

Fifty-one percent of patients choose digital tools for scheduling and check-in when provided, according to a recent study by NRC Health, reflecting a change in the default setting for their expectations.

3. Accuracy in Data Collection

The addition of human error to the process that flows through hands, over paper, and into the EMR can lead to coding errors or billing errors. Aila’s kiosks scan using images, generating clean, structured data instantly and cutting down on errors and data entry.

4. Improved Operational Productivity

Healthcare worker shortages remain a serious issue. With Aila, you can move front-desk staff off from clicking and typing their way through patient admin into more meaningful patient interaction and care coordination.

Implementing a Contactless Kiosk: What You Need to Know

Deploying patient check-in kiosks in a healthcare setting requires planning. At Aila, we’ve helped providers across urgent care, diagnostics, and outpatient settings launch successful self-service strategies. Here are a few steps to consider:

Hardware Setup

Select from countertop, wall-mount, or freestanding kiosks based on your lobby design and patient flow.

Software Configuration

Customize the interface for your workflows, scanning, e-signature, payment, or multilingual support.

Staff Training

Prepare your team to assist and educate patients on using the new system. Aila can provide training support and documentation to make this easy.

Workflow Integration

Map how the kiosk will fit into existing intake workflows to ensure a smooth transition for patients and staff alike.
